One of the driving forces behind LG’s winning streak is its strength in close combat.

Changwon LG won 76-74 in the home game against Wonju DB held at Changwon Gymnasium on the 3rd, recording 24 wins and 13 losses, securing the sole second place.

LG stayed in 7th place with a record of 24 wins and 30 losses last season. This season, in 37 games, he won the same number of wins as last season.

In the 2020-2021 season, it was the first team to finish last with only 19 wins (35 losses). In the 2019-2020 season, when the season was suspended in the aftermath of Corona 19, it was also sluggish with 16 wins and 26 losses.

LG is highly likely to reach 30+ in 4 seasons after the 2018-2019 season, which recorded 30 wins and 24 losses. This is because in the 2018-2019 season, the same 37 match results as this season were 19 wins and 18 losses.

Considering that the scoring power is 8th overall with 78.8 points, it can be seen that LG is a team that makes a living on defense.

LG is strong in close combat thanks to this.

The same goes for Gyeonggi-do today. LG, which was trailing by 17 points in the second quarter, tied the score at 36-36 at the end of the first half.

It was a close match in the second half. LG had a slight lead after the middle of the 3rd quarter, but it was reversed 74-73 with 2 minutes and 1 second left in the 4th quarter. LG ended up winning the game by 2 points thanks to Lee Jae-do’s final goal.
